#89153d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#89153d is composed of 53.7% red, 8.2%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.7%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 339.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 31%. #89153d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a7a with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#89153d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#89153d has RGB values of R:137, G:21,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.55,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 8983869.

Shades and Tints of #89153d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deff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#89153d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524c4e is the less saturated color, while #9b0337 is the most saturated one.
